TASTING NOTES: We taste molasses initially developing into dulce de leche and finishing with guava notes.

5 INGREDIENTS: Cacao, sugar, cacao butter from Esmeraldas., Salt, and Andean Flowers

CACAO ORIGIN: Esmeraldas - Ecuador

SUGAR ORIGIN: Panela de Pacto (unrefined sugar)

AG-PRACTICES: Regenerative, Permaculture, Agroforestry

SOCIAL IMPACT: Community empowerment, Food sovereignty

FOUNDER: Lascano Siblings  

ALLERGY INFORMATION: Vegan, Peanut free, soy free, treenut free, gluten free.

Meet the Founders

Born in the Ecuadorian Amazon, two brothers and a sister reunited around 2022 with their German-American sister-in-law to found THRIVU—a regenerative chocolate company rooted in family, forest, and fairness. Inspired by their childhood ‘tribu’ and driven by a dream to restore the land, they keep value at origin, crafting chocolate that helps communities and nature thrive.
